SALT LAKE CITY, Utah – Former BYU star Jordan Matyas and the U.S. women’s rugby sevens got the win in the team’s opening match in the Olympic tournament in Tokyo.
The Americans started slow, giving up a try to start the game, and going down 7-0 to the Chinese after a successful conversion.
However, the U.S. answered with 28 unanswered points, taking a 28-7 lead until the final seconds.

Matyas played just four minutes, and didn’t register anything on the final stat sheet.
The Women’s Eagles will play next early Thursday morning against Japan. That match will take place at 3:00 a.m. in Utah and will be televised live on USA Network.
